A recent social media discussion has caught attention, merging garden-fresh vegetables with crypto culture. In an unusual take, some forums are buzzing about the role of data centers alongside growing food, raising questions about consumer habits in the crypto community.

Context of the Discussion

The idea sparked interest after a forum post likened the necessity for both farming and crypto mining. Users weighed in with mixed opinions on the relationship between these two seemingly unrelated worlds. The conversation highlights a stark contrast between traditional agriculture and modern technology use, specifically cryptocurrency mining.

"Maybe I'm out of touch with the crypto scene, but I find it unlikely that many of those folk know how to grow vegetables," remarked one skeptical commenter.

Themes Emerging from the Comments

Several recurring themes emerged as people expressed their views:

  1. Skepticism about Farming Skills

    Many commenters questioned whether the crypto crowd possesses the knowledge needed for farming. โ€œThey probably donโ€™t know how hard subsistence farming is,โ€ stated one critical voice.

  2. Perceived Dietary Habits

    Comments highlighted assumptions about the eating habits of crypto enthusiasts, with one stating, โ€œSince when do crypto bros eat anything other than burgers and fries?โ€ This suggests a disconnect between healthy, sustainable eating and popular crypto culture.

  3. Irony of Consumerism

    A nuanced perspective expressed that removing the crypto branding from a data center could make it appear as a meaningful statement against consumerism. โ€œEdit out the Bitcoin stamp on that building, and itโ€™s actually a wholesome message,โ€ noted an observer.

Sentiment Patterns

The discourse remained a mix of humor and skepticism. While some maintained a light-hearted tone, others voiced genuine concerns about knowledge gaps in farming within the crypto community.
